Merge Two Pangenomes Tools

Advertisement

Merge two pangenomes tools has become an essential task in comparative genomics, allowing researchers to integrate multiple pangenomic datasets into a unified framework. As the volume and complexity of genomic data grow, the need for robust, efficient, and accurate methods to combine pangenomes is increasingly critical. This article explores the landscape of tools designed to merge two pangenomes, examining their methodologies, advantages, limitations, and best practices to ensure meaningful biological insights.

Introduction to Pangenomes and the Need for Merging Tools



What Is a Pangenome?


A pangenome encompasses the entire set of genes within a species, including core genes present in all individuals and accessory genes found only in some. It provides a comprehensive view of genetic diversity, evolutionary dynamics, and functional potential within a species or population.

Why Merge Pangenomes?


Merging pangenomes is motivated by multiple scientific and practical reasons:
- Integration of datasets obtained from different studies or sequencing platforms.
- Comparison across populations or species, requiring a unified reference.
- Updating existing pangenomes with new data without starting from scratch.
- Enhancing the resolution of genomic variation analysis through combined datasets.

Challenges in Merging Pangenomes


Despite its importance, merging pangenomes presents challenges:
- Variability in gene annotations and assemblies.
- Structural variations and complex genomic rearrangements.
- Differences in the representation formats and data models.
- Handling large-scale data efficiently.

Overview of Existing Pangenome Merging Tools



Several tools and pipelines have been developed to facilitate merging pangenomes. These can be broadly categorized based on their underlying methodologies and data formats.

1. Roary and Its Derivatives


Roary is a popular tool for pangenome analysis based on gene presence-absence matrices. While primarily designed for individual pangenome construction, it can be adapted to merge datasets by combining core and accessory gene clusters.

- Methodology: Uses BLASTp comparisons, clustering genes into orthologous groups.
- Limitations: Not optimized for large-scale or highly divergent genomes; merging requires reconciling gene clusters manually or through additional scripts.

2. Panaroo


Panaroo is an advanced pangenome pipeline that improves accuracy by correcting assembly errors and dealing with paralogs.

- Methodology: Graph-based approach representing the pangenome as a gene adjacency graph.
- Merging capability: Can incorporate multiple datasets by merging graphs, aligning shared nodes, and updating the graph structure.
- Advantages: Handles structural variations and complex gene presence patterns effectively.

3. PPanGGOLiN


PPanGGOLiN (Partitioned Pangenome Graph Of Linked Neighbors) models the pangenome as a graph with partitions, enabling sophisticated analyses.

- Methodology: Uses a probabilistic model to classify genes into persistent, shell, and cloud categories.
- Merging approach: Combines multiple pangenomes by integrating their graphs and re-estimating partitions.
- Strengths: Robust to data heterogeneity and supports scalable analysis.

4. Genome Graph Tools (e.g., PGGB, vg toolkit)


Genome graph-based tools represent genomes as variation graphs, allowing integration of multiple genomes.

- Methodology: Construct variation graphs capturing structural variations, then merge graphs.
- Application: Suitable for merging large, complex pangenomes with structural variants.
- Advantages: Preserves structural information and facilitates complex comparative analyses.

Methodologies for Merging Two Pangenomes



Merging pangenomes generally involves several key steps. These can be adapted depending on the specific tools and data formats used.

1. Data Standardization and Preprocessing


Before merging, datasets should be standardized:
- Convert to compatible formats (e.g., GFA, GFF, or custom formats).
- Harmonize gene annotations and naming conventions.
- Remove redundancies and resolve conflicts in gene identifiers.

2. Alignment and Clustering


Identify shared and unique elements:
- Use sequence similarity tools like BLASTp or DIAMOND.
- Cluster genes into orthologous groups.
- Detect structural variations and rearrangements.

3. Graph Construction and Integration


Build a unified graph:
- For graph-based tools, merge individual graphs into a combined structure.
- For matrix-based approaches, integrate presence-absence matrices.

4. Handling Conflicts and Duplicates


Resolve discrepancies:
- Reconcile conflicting annotations.
- Collapse redundant gene clusters.
- Address paralogs and gene duplications.

5. Final Annotation and Validation


Annotate the merged pangenome:
- Assign functional annotations.
- Validate the integrity of the merged dataset.
- Perform quality checks for completeness and accuracy.

Best Practices and Considerations



To ensure successful merging of pangenomes, consider the following best practices:

- Use high-quality assemblies: Poor assemblies can introduce errors that complicate merging.
- Standardize data formats: Consistent formats facilitate automation and reduce errors.
- Incorporate metadata: Include information about sample origin, sequencing platform, and assembly methods.
- Iterative validation: Perform multiple rounds of validation and refinement.
- Leverage visualization tools: Use visualization (e.g., Bandage, Graphviz) to interpret complex graph structures.
- Document workflows: Maintain detailed records of parameters and methods for reproducibility.

Future Directions in Pangenome Merging



The field is rapidly evolving with emerging technologies and methodologies:
- Machine learning approaches to improve ortholog detection and conflict resolution.
- Integration with functional data such as transcriptomics or epigenomics.
- Development of standardized formats and APIs for interoperability.
- Cloud-based platforms enabling scalable and collaborative analyses.

Conclusion



Merging two pangenomes is a complex yet vital process in modern genomics, enabling comprehensive insights into genetic diversity, evolution, and functional potential. A variety of tools—ranging from gene clustering algorithms like Roary to graph-based frameworks like vg—offer different advantages tailored to specific datasets and research questions. Successful merging relies on careful preprocessing, methodological rigor, and validation, ensuring that the integrated pangenome accurately reflects biological realities.

As genomic datasets continue to expand, the development of more sophisticated, scalable, and user-friendly merging tools will be essential. By understanding the methodologies, strengths, and limitations of existing tools, researchers can select appropriate strategies to advance their comparative genomics studies and unlock the full potential of pangenomic data.

---

References:

- Page, A. J., et al. (2015). Roary: Rapid large-scale prokaryote pan genome analysis. Bioinformatics, 31(22), 3691–3693.
- Tonkin-Hill, G., et al. (2020). Producing polished prokaryotic pangenomes with Panaroo. Genome Biology, 21(1), 1-21.
- G voli, V., et al. (2020). PPanGGOLiN: Software for pangenome analysis with graph partitioning. Bioinformatics, 36(21), 5403–5404.
- Garrison, E., et al. (2018). Variation graph toolkit improves read mapping by representing genetic variation in the reference structure. Nature Biotechnology, 36(9), 875–879.

Frequently Asked Questions


What are the main benefits of merging two pangenome tools?

Merging two pangenome tools allows for comprehensive analysis by combining their unique features, improves accuracy in gene presence-absence variation detection, and enhances the ability to handle diverse genomic datasets efficiently.

Which factors should I consider when choosing two pangenome tools to merge?

Consider compatibility in data formats, computational efficiency, scalability, community support, and whether the tools complement each other's strengths to ensure a seamless merging process.

Are there existing workflows or pipelines for integrating two pangenome tools?

Yes, several workflows exist that facilitate integration, often involving standard data formats like GFF or FASTA, and tools like Snakemake or Nextflow can help orchestrate the merging process for reproducibility.

What challenges might I face when merging two pangenome tools?

Challenges include handling different data formats, aligning results from different algorithms, managing computational resources, and ensuring the integrity and consistency of the combined output.

Can merging two pangenome tools improve the detection of structural variants?

Yes, combining tools with complementary algorithms can enhance structural variant detection by leveraging different methodologies and increasing the sensitivity and specificity of results.

Is it possible to automate the merging of two pangenome tools for large-scale analyses?

Absolutely, with scripting and workflow management systems like Snakemake or Nextflow, automation is feasible, enabling scalable and reproducible large-scale pangenome analyses.

What are some recommended tools or methods for merging pangenome datasets?

Tools like PanTools, Roary, and Panaroo can be used in conjunction with custom scripts or workflow managers to merge datasets effectively, depending on the specific requirements and data formats involved.